Understanding PET Plastic
PET plastic is a thermoplastic polymer resin known for its strength, flexibility, and durability. It is widely used due to its excellent barrier properties, making it an ideal choice for packaging food and beverages. In the context of pet products, PET plastic is often molded into various shapes and sizes to create items that are not only functional but also safe for pets.
The Molding Process
The molding of PET plastic involves several steps. The most common method is injection molding, where heated PET material is injected into a mold under pressure. This process allows for the creation of complex shapes and ensures that each product is manufactured to the highest standards of quality. Other techniques include blow molding, which is used for hollow items like bottles, and thermoforming, valuable for creating shallow containers.
During the molding process, the temperature is carefully controlled to ensure that the PET retains its desirable properties. This precision is crucial to producing durable products that withstand the wear and tear associated with pet use. Benefits of Using PET Plastic
One of the primary advantages of PET plastic in pet products is its safety. PET is non-toxic and free from harmful chemicals like BPA, making it safe for pets to interact with. Furthermore, its resistance to moisture and chemicals ensures that food and water containers do not leach harmful substances, promoting the health of pets.
Another significant benefit is the lightweight nature of PET plastic. This characteristic is particularly important for products that pet owners frequently carry, such as travel water bottles or portable food containers. The ease of transport encourages pet owners to keep their pets well-hydrated and fed, regardless of location.
Moreover, PET plastic is recyclable, contributing to a more sustainable future. Many companies in the pet industry are now embracing circular economy principles by using recycled PET (rPET) in their products. This approach not only reduces waste but also conserves resources, aligning with the values of environmentally conscious consumers.
